Conveyor roller bearings represent a critical component in the smooth and consistent operation of any conveyor system. To enhance their lifespan and performance, regular maintenance is crucial. This includes consistently inspecting the bearings for signs of damage, such as abnormal operation, excessive friction, or observable damage to the bearings. Furthermore, it is necessary to lubricate the bearings in line with the manufacturer's guidelines to minimize friction and extend their service life.

Minimizing Friction with High-Performance Conveyor Bearings
In the demanding world of material handling, friction can be a significant impediment to efficiency and productivity. High-performance conveyor bearings play a vital role in minimizing friction, ensuring smooth and reliable operation of goods along conveyor systems. These specialized bearings are engineered with advanced materials and designs that minimize friction coefficients, leading to improved energy efficiency, reduced wear and tear on components, and enhanced overall system performance.
- By employing low-friction lubricants, conveyor bearings create a smooth interface between moving parts, minimizing frictional forces.
- High-quality bearing metals and precision manufacturing tolerances contribute to reduced friction and increased lifespan.
- Innovative designs such as sealed bearings restrict the entry of contaminants, further minimizing friction and extending operational life.
Choosing the right high-performance conveyor bearings can significantly impact your material handling operations. Factors to consider include load capacity, operating speed, environmental conditions, and desired levels of friction reduction. By carefully selecting and maintaining these critical components, you can enhance the efficiency, reliability, and longevity of your conveyor systems.
Roller Bearing Lubrication for Conveyors
Keeping conveyor roller bearings properly lubricated is essential for optimal performance. Regular lubrication reduces friction between the moving parts, extending their lifespan and avoiding premature wear and tear. The schedule of lubrication will vary on factors such as the intensity of usage, the type of climate, and the specific characteristics of the lubricant being used.
It's important to choose a lubricant that is compatible for the more info components in your conveyor system and the operating temperature. Check the manufacturer's suggestions for the best lubrication practices for your specific conveyor roller bearings.
Troubleshooting Common Conveyor Roller Bearing Issues
Conveyor roller bearings are essential components in a variety of industrial processes. proper operation on these bearings is crucial for ensuring conveyor system performance and minimizing downtime. Nevertheless, roller bearings can be susceptible to a number of issues that can affect their functionality.
Some common problems include:
- Worn bearings
- Insufficient lubrication
- Incorrect alignment
- Heavy strain
Identifying these issues early on is vital for preventing more serious damage and costly repairs. A regular examination of your conveyor roller bearings can assist you to identify potential problems before they escalate.
